Output 7897fa3ee894a4b49e6c88f5d586579d75a1508865488e9bbc83db4d585361b8:1

value
4636138052
script pubkey
OP_0 OP_PUSHBYTES_20 ba7e73c9f1fd3f04638ca140b2accb6028e818a5
address
tb1qhfl88j03l5lsgcuv59qt9txtvq5wsx99dyeys0
transaction
7897fa3ee894a4b49e6c88f5d586579d75a1508865488e9bbc83db4d585361b8
confirmations
109147
spent
true